Data: PeckShield, Nearly $200 millions lost in crypto security incidents in November, a month-on-month increase of 969%
According to ChainCatcher, PeckShield statistics show that there were about 15 major cryptocurrency attack incidents in 2025, resulting in total losses of approximately $194.27 million, a surge of 969% compared to October’s $18.18 million.
The five largest attack incidents were: Balancer v2 and its branches with losses of $137.4 million (of which $39 million has been recovered), an exchange with losses of $36 million, Yearn Finance with losses of $9 million, HLP bad debt of $4.95 million, and GANA PayFi with losses of $3.1 million.
